This long péniche may look like prime wedding-reception and bar-mitzvah party turf (which, in fact, it is), but come summer it turns into the venue of choice for local electronic labels. The top-deck terrace provides plenty of air, but go below and you’ll find a long, narrow, neon-lit dance floor pumping with house and techno from Ed Banger Records and the like. Respect Wednesdays are especially hot - free and packed before 10pm, although the main acts usually don’t drop the needle ’til after 1am.
